2019 SASI Scholarships
Published Thu 23 Aug 2018
The 2019 round of the SASI Individual Athlete Program opened on Wednesday 22 August 2018 at 12:00pm, and will close on Wednesday 26 September 2018 at 12:00pm.
The 2019 SASI IAP includes the Individual Athlete Scholarships (IAS) and the Country Athlete Awards (CAA). Here are some criteria to help determine if you are eligible. More information about the guidelines and eligibility can be found at http://ors.sa.gov.au/funding?a=144892.
IAS
· Competing in an Olympic, Paralympic or Commonwealth Games sport and discipline;
· Able to demonstrate the ability to be selected onto the next national team for the international benchmark event relevant to their age, e.g. Senior/U23/Junior World Championships;
· Engaged in a comprehensive program of intensive training and international competition;
· Athletes already on a SASI Sport Program Scholarship are ineligible.
CAA
· South Australian athletes with primary residence 130km or more from the Adelaide GPO. Kangaroo Island residents are eligible to apply;
· Competing in an Olympic, Paralympic or Commonwealth Games sport and discipline;
· Aged between 13 and 18 inclusive, on 31 December 2018;
· Recognised as having the ability to reach the senior elite level of competition;
· Recognised as having the potential to transition into a SASI sport program or Individual Athlete Scholarship.
